A colocation provider will rent out space in a data centre in which customers can install their equipment, but will also provide the power, bandwidth, IP address and cooling systems that the customer will require in order to successfully deploy their server.
Colocation allows you to place your server machine in someone else's rack and share their bandwidth as your own. It generally costs more than standard Web hosting, but less than a comparable amount of bandwidth into your place of business.
Colocation (also known as ‘co-location’ or ‘colo’) is the practice of housing privately-owned servers and networking equipment in a third party data centre. Instead of keeping servers in-house, in offices or at a private data centre.

Colocated hosting provider is responsible for the security and upkeep of the facility, so that the space, power and bandwidth that they provide you are not compromised. As you can see, colocation is much more of a hands-on, do-it-yourself solution, as opposed to managed hosting.
